tough to tell from that pic. I want them to sit just inside.... I'm not opposed to rolling the fenders... but from the tire calculator i found online i would need 66mm offset to stay where yours sit

Correct, if you wanted the outside of the 10" wheel to sit exactly as the 9.5" wheels do with the +60mm offset you will need a +66mm offset on the 10" wheel.
Previous poster's math was a little off. 60mm + 12.5mm/2 = 66mm for your 10" wheel. The offset must be added in order to keep the outside of the wheel face at the same plane as the original. The addition of only 6mm and not 12 is necessary because relative to the center of the wheel the 10" is 6mm larger on each side than the 9.5mm wheel.

What you can do is pull your hubs off and put a new set of holes for wheel studs on the mustang bolt center. They will fit in the spaces between the current studs. I almost did it on my car for my snow tires, I have a set of mustang wheels with snows on them, but found a set of lincoln wheels. With the right equipment it would not be hard to do.
 
all i have for that wold be a drill press.... and I doubt thats enough. I 'm wondering what kind of place would do that. Machine shop might, maybe a auto shop...idk
 
You would definately want a machine shop, it can be done on a mill. The fronts will be a little tricky to hold, but it is doable. There rears will be really easy. I would say this would be a better option than trying to get wheels custom set up for the lincoln bolt pattern, then you would be able to use any mustang wheel.
